Wet Vacuum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Standing water in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Y extraction is usually effective for small areas, but be cautious of safety risks and potential structural damage.
Water damage in a large area (over 1000 sq. Ft.) No Yes Professional help is required for extensive water damage to ensure thorough extraction, drying, and sanitation.
Hidden water damage (behind walls or under flooring) No Yes Professional help is required to detect and address hidden water damage, which can cause significant structural issues if left untreated.
Water damage with mold or mildew presence No Yes Professional help is required to safely remove mold and mildew, which can pose health risks if not handled properly.
Water damage in a high-traffic area or commercial space No Yes Professional help is required to address water damage in high-traffic areas or commercial spaces due to the complexity and potential risks involved.
Water damage with electrical or gas issues No Yes Professional help is required to safely address water damage with electrical or gas issues, which can pose significant safety risks if not handled properly.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Crittenden, VA

The cost of wet vacuum water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Crittenden, VA.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ect your specific situation. Call us for a free estimate. We’ll provide a customized quote based on your needs. Don’t hesitate to ask questions.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ction (less than 100 sq. Ft.) $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, type of flooring or materials, and equipment required.
Water Extraction (100-1000 sq. Ft.) $2,500 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, type of flooring or materials, equipment required, and labor costs.
Drying and Sanitation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ials, equipment required, and labor costs.
Final Treatment and Inspection $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ials, and equipment required.
Hidden Water Damage Detection $1,500 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ials, and equipment required.
Mold and Mildew Removal $2,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ials, equipment required, and labor costs.
